Am happy to announce that the 1952-54 Fuel Injection Spl is ready. Kit is complete and has 44 parts. resin, metal, and windshield. Indycals has the 1952 set when the car was #26, and the '53-54 set when the car was #14. Also new to the Indycals inventory; this kit can be built as the 1955 third place Bardhal Spl #15 driven by Jimmy Davies. Price is $85 + $5 shipping. I believe Indycals sells the decal sheets for $6.
